Transaction 2576f7ddeed648217dc74d4f0afcf63ed1740981c096eac2f4e80a68c948d23b
1 Input
1 Output
-
2576f7ddeed648217dc74d4f0afcf63ed1740981c096eac2f4e80a68c948d23b:0
- value
- 148601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20a5b821e30c3ed53c2e55867d8440e9dac96923 OP_EQUAL
- address
- 34fe54NGjzjvg5sHno7fVNdmL3tZdpcTgf